#include #include "esp_event.h" #include "esp_log.h" #include "esp_wifi.h" #include "esp_wifi_default.h" #include "esp_netif.h" #include "esp_http_client.h" #include "esp_sleep.h" #include "freertos/FreeRTOS.h" #include "freertos/event_groups.h" #include "epd7in3e.h" #include "status_screen.h" #include "frame_client.h" static const char *TAG = "frame_client"; #define STA_CONNECTED_BIT BIT0 #define STA_FAILED_BIT BIT1 static EventGroupHandle_t s_sta_event_group; /* wifi_sta_config_t's ssid/password fields are fixed-size byte arrays, not * necessarily null-terminated (a full 32-char SSID fills the field exactly). * snprintf() flags that as a possible truncation at -Werror, so copy by * hand instead. */ static void copy_wifi_field(uint8_t *dst, size_t dst_size, const char *src) { size_t len = strnlen(src, dst_size); memcpy(dst, src, len); if (len < dst_size) { dst[len] = '\0'; } } static void sta_event_handler(void *arg, esp_event_base_t event_base, int32_t event_id, void *event_data) { if (event_base == WIFI_EVENT && event_id == WIFI_EVENT_STA_START) { esp_wifi_connect(); } else if (event_base == WIFI_EVENT && event_id == WIFI_EVENT_STA_DISCONNECTED) { ESP_LOGW(TAG, "Disconnected from home WiFi"); xEventGroupSetBits(s_sta_event_group, STA_FAILED_BIT); } else if (event_base == IP_EVENT && event_id == IP_EVENT_STA_GOT_IP) { ip_event_got_ip_t *event = (ip_event_got_ip_t *)event_data; ESP_LOGI(TAG, "Got IP: " IPSTR, IP2STR(&event->ip_info.ip)); xEventGroupSetBits(s_sta_event_group, STA_CONNECTED_BIT); } } esp_err_t frame_wifi_connect_sta(const frame_config_t *cfg) { s_sta_event_group = xEventGroupCreate(); esp_netif_t *sta_netif = esp_netif_create_default_wifi_sta(); wifi_init_config_t init_cfg = WIFI_INIT_CONFIG_DEFAULT(); ESP_ERROR_CHECK(esp_wifi_init(&init_cfg)); esp_event_handler_instance_t wifi_handler; esp_event_handler_instance_t ip_handler; ESP_ERROR_CHECK(esp_event_handler_instance_register(WIFI_EVENT, ESP_EVENT_ANY_ID, &sta_event_handler, NULL, &wifi_handler)); ESP_ERROR_CHECK(esp_event_handler_instance_register(IP_EVENT, IP_EVENT_STA_GOT_IP, &sta_event_handler, NULL, &ip_handler)); wifi_config_t wifi_config = {0}; copy_wifi_field(wifi_config.sta.ssid, sizeof(wifi_config.sta.ssid), cfg->sta_ssid); copy_wifi_field(wifi_config.sta.password, sizeof(wifi_config.sta.password), cfg->sta_password); ESP_ERROR_CHECK(esp_wifi_set_mode(WIFI_MODE_STA)); ESP_ERROR_CHECK(esp_wifi_set_config(WIFI_IF_STA, &wifi_config)); ESP_ERROR_CHECK(esp_wifi_start()); esp_err_t result = ESP_FAIL; for (int attempt = 1; attempt <= CONFIG_FRAME_STA_CONNECT_MAX_RETRIES; attempt++) { ESP_LOGI(TAG, "Connecting to '%s' (attempt %d/%d)", cfg->sta_ssid, attempt, CONFIG_FRAME_STA_CONNECT_MAX_RETRIES); xEventGroupClearBits(s_sta_event_group, STA_CONNECTED_BIT | STA_FAILED_BIT); esp_wifi_connect(); EventBits_t bits = xEventGroupWaitBits(s_sta_event_group, STA_CONNECTED_BIT | STA_FAILED_BIT, pdTRUE, pdFALSE, pdMS_TO_TICKS(CONFIG_FRAME_STA_CONNECT_TIMEOUT_MS)); if (bits & STA_CONNECTED_BIT) { result = ESP_OK; break; } ESP_LOGW(TAG, "Attempt %d/%d failed", attempt, CONFIG_FRAME_STA_CONNECT_MAX_RETRIES); } esp_event_handler_instance_unregister(WIFI_EVENT, ESP_EVENT_ANY_ID, wifi_handler); esp_event_handler_instance_unregister(IP_EVENT, IP_EVENT_STA_GOT_IP, ip_handler); vEventGroupDelete(s_sta_event_group); s_sta_event_group = NULL; if (result != ESP_OK) { /* Fully tear the WiFi driver back down on failure -- the caller * falls back to provisioning, which calls esp_wifi_init() again * for AP mode. Leaving the driver merely stopped (rather than * deinitialized) made that second esp_wifi_init() call fail with * 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E and abort, confirmed on hardware. */ esp_wifi_stop(); esp_wifi_deinit(); esp_netif_destroy_default_wifi(sta_netif); } return result; } /* Probes cfg->toolsserver with a plain HTTP HEAD -- any HTTP response * (even a 404, since there's no server yet to define real routes) means * the socket-level connection succeeded, which is all this is checking. */ static bool check_server_reachable(const char *toolsserver) { char url[160]; snprintf(url, sizeof(url), "http://%s/", toolsserver); esp_http_client_config_t config = { .url = url, .method = HTTP_METHOD_HEAD, .timeout_ms = CONFIG_FRAME_SERVER_CHECK_TIMEOUT_MS, }; esp_http_client_handle_t client = esp_http_client_init(&config); esp_err_t err = esp_http_client_perform(client); esp_http_client_cleanup(client); if (err != ESP_OK) { ESP_LOGW(TAG, "Server '%s' not reachable: %s", toolsserver, esp_err_to_name(err)); } return err == ESP_OK; } typedef struct { esp_http_client_handle_t client; } http_read_ctx_t; /* Pulls the next chunk straight out of the in-progress HTTP response -- * epd_display_stream() calls this to feed the panel without ever holding * the full ~192KB frame in RAM. */ static size_t http_read_fn(uint8_t *chunk, size_t chunk_size, void *ctx_) { http_read_ctx_t *ctx = (http_read_ctx_t *)ctx_; int n = esp_http_client_read(ctx->client, (char *)chunk, (int)chunk_size); return n > 0 ? (size_t)n : 0; } /* GETs /frame/image and streams the response directly into the panel. */ static esp_err_t fetch_and_display(const frame_config_t *cfg) { char url[160]; snprintf(url, sizeof(url), "http://%s/frame/image", cfg->toolsserver); esp_http_client_config_t config = { .url = url, .method = HTTP_METHOD_GET, .timeout_ms = CONFIG_FRAME_FETCH_TIMEOUT_MS, }; esp_http_client_handle_t client = esp_http_client_init(&config); esp_err_t err = esp_http_client_open(client, 0); if (err != ESP_OK) { ESP_LOGE(TAG, "Failed to open '%s': %s", url, esp_err_to_name(err)); esp_http_client_cleanup(client); return err; } int content_length = esp_http_client_fetch_headers(client); int status = esp_http_client_get_status_code(client); if (status != 200) { ESP_LOGE(TAG, "'%s' returned HTTP %d", url, status); esp_http_client_close(client); esp_http_client_cleanup(client); return ESP_FAIL; } ESP_LOGI(TAG, "Fetching frame (%d bytes) from '%s'", content_length, url); http_read_ctx_t ctx = { .client = client }; err = epd_display_stream(http_read_fn, &ctx); esp_http_client_close(client); esp_http_client_cleanup(client); return err; } void frame_client_run(const frame_config_t *cfg) { esp_err_t epd_err = epd_init(); bool have_display = (epd_err == ESP_OK); if (!have_display) { ESP_LOGW(TAG, "EPD init failed (%s), continuing without display", esp_err_to_name(epd_err)); } uint32_t sleep_seconds = CONFIG_FRAME_SLEEP_INTERVAL_S; bool server_reachable = check_server_reachable(cfg->toolsserver); if (!server_reachable) { /* Nothing's been drawn yet this cycle, so this is the only * refresh -- cheap diagnostics without compounding flashing. */ ESP_LOGW(TAG, "Tools server not reachable, retrying sooner"); sleep_seconds = CONFIG_FRAME_RETRY_INTERVAL_S; if (have_display) { status_screen_show(cfg->sta_ssid, STATUS_OK, cfg->toolsserver, STATUS_FAILED); } } else if (have_display) { esp_err_t fetch_err = fetch_and_display(cfg); if (fetch_err != ESP_OK) { /* The panel may have already partially refreshed with a * truncated frame by this point -- log and retry sooner * rather than drawing a second status screen on top of it. */ ESP_LOGW(TAG, "Fetch/display failed (%s), retrying sooner", esp_err_to_name(fetch_err)); sleep_seconds = CONFIG_FRAME_RETRY_INTERVAL_S; } } if (have_display) { epd_sleep(); } ESP_LOGI(TAG, "Deep sleeping for %u seconds", (unsigned)sleep_seconds); esp_sleep_enable_timer_wakeup((uint64_t)sleep_seconds * 1000000ULL); esp_deep_sleep_start(); }
